New Years Eve Dinner.
My wife and I had new years eve dinner at soleil. The amuse bouche was tasteless, dry and unappetizing. The salad was okay but uninspired. The lobster dish was raw and tasteless. The filet mignon was chewy and the desert was very very dry. The mignardises (little sweets for after the meal) came in singles so we didnt have one for each of us but anyway they were not good. We only got one roll each and when it was finished we werent even asked if we would like more. The glass of wine we ordered for the meat course came when we were halfway finished.
When we told the hostess about this she said she was sorry and offered us some more of the tasteless sweets. We refuse this of course. Why would we want to eat more of that stuff?
